    The Italian enclave San Marino has its own country code 378, but landline numbers can be reached using the Italian country code as well: the prefix "0549" is assigned to San Marino. Dialing either "+378 xxxxxx" or "+39 0549 xxxxxx" will reach the same number. Mobile phone customers are sometimes assigned Italian phone numbers.

    A personal identification number (PIN), PIN code, or sometimes redundantly a PIN number, is a numeric (sometimes alpha-numeric) passcode used in the process of authenticating a user accessing a system.

    Landline telephone numbers have area codes, whereas mobile numbers do not. In major cities, landline numbers consist of a two-digit area code followed by an eight-digit local number. In other places, landline numbers consist of a three-digit area code followed by a seven- or eight-digit local number. Mobile phone numbers consist of eleven digits.

    The Work Number is an American employment verification database created in 1985 by Talx Corporation.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] [ 3 ] Talx, (now Equifax Workforce Solutions ) was acquired by Equifax Inc. in February 2007 for US$ 1.4 billion.
